Note to Assignors:
If the
state approval
shows the referee status to be N/A, please contact your DRA. The DRA needs to contact the SRA with the test date and location the referee took and passed the certification for 2011. The SRA will then set the
state approval
to
yes.

Note:
MRL, TPL and Ohio League games do not need reported in GotSoccer. All other leagues use GotSoccer and filing the reports online is mandatory.
